hurd: handle EINTR during critical sections
During critical sections, signal handling is deferred and thus RPCs return
EINTR, even if SA_RESTART is set. We thus have to restart the whole critical
section in that case.

This also adds HURD_CRITICAL_UNLOCK in the cases where one wants to
break the section in the middle.
